There are around 90 naturally occurring elements that consist of only one type of atom listed on the Periodic Table.
Elements chemically combine to produce molecules. Molecules are two or more atoms bonded together.
Compounds are two or more different atomschemically bonded together.
In chemical reactions, molecules of elements and compounds interact and rearrange to form new compounds. Elements are made up of single types of atoms, while compounds are made up of different types of atoms bonded together. During a chemical reaction, the bonds between atoms in molecules are broken and new bonds are formed, resulting in the creation of different compounds.
Chemical bonds, such as covalent bonds and ionic bonds, link elements together to form compounds. These compounds have distinct molecular structures based on the arrangement of their constituent atoms. The type and strength of the bond between elements influence the properties of the resulting molecules.
A compound is formed by the combining of elements or other compounds through chemical reactions. Compounds are made up of molecules that contain two or more different elements chemically bonded together in a fixed ratio. These chemical bonds are formed by the sharing or transfer of electrons between atoms.

One defining characteristic of a chemical compound is the inclusion of two or more chemical elements. When atoms of those different elements bond in a fixed ratio, the resulting molecules constitute a chemical compound. Molecules of a single chemical element (such as O2) are not considered compounds.
